- 1、本文档共30页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
教程第6章
2. 使用列表框显示数据 中的文本框改为列表框(如图所示)。 将窗体中的文本框换为列表框,无需修改列表框的属性, 只修改命令按钮的Click事件代码: Private Sub Command1_Click() List1.Clear For n = 1001 To 1100 Step 2 s = 0 For i = 2 To Int(Sqr(n)) If n Mod i = 0 Then s = 1 : Exit For End If Next If s = 0 Then List1.AddItem n 使用列表框的Add方法增加列表项 Next End Sub * 第6章 循环结构程序设计 人民邮电出版社 21世纪高等学校计算机基础课系列教材 循环结构程序设计 For循环结构 For循环用于控制循环次数预知的循环结构。它的语法如下: For 循环变量=初值 To 终值 [Step 步长] 语句块1 [Exit For] [语句块2] Next [循环变量] 其中:循环变量必须是一个数值型的变量,一般多用整型。 循环结构程序设计 T F T F 循环变量小于终值 语句块1 开始(start) …… …… 结束(end) 循环变量的初值 Exit For 语句块2 改变循环变量的值(循环变量加步长) 利用For循环结构显示1000以内的所有能被37整除的自然数。 设计步骤如下: (1) 窗体界面的设计与属性设置。 (2) 编写代码。 编写命令按钮的Click事件代码: Private Sub Command1_Click() a = For n = 1 To 1000 If n Mod 37 = 0 Then a = a Str(n) vbCrLf End If Next Text1.Text = a End Sub 能被37整除的自然数 Do … Loop结构 当不知道循环的次数的时候,或者在循环次数不确定的情况下,就不能再用For循环结构来实现程序的设计了,Visual Basic中提供了一个这样的结构,这就是Do … Loop结构。这种结构有两种不同的形式,下面分别讲解。 Do While … Loop结构 这种形式是首先判断条件是否满足,然后根据条件来决定是否执行后面的语句(循环体)。这种结构的语法形式为: 循环结构程序设计的概念 Do…Loop语句 前测型Do…Loop循环 其语法为 Do [{ While | Until }〈条件〉] [〈语句列1〉] [Exit Do] [〈语句列2〉] Loop F T F 条件表达式? 语句块 开始(start) …… …… 结束(end) 条件表达式的初值 Exit Do? 语句块2 改变条件表达式 求累加和1 + 2 + 3 +…+ 100(如)。 求累加和 设计步骤如下: 窗体界面的设计参见前面章节,这里仅给出命令按钮的Click事件代码: Private Sub Command1_Click() Dim s As Integer, n As Integer s = 0: n = 1 Do While n = 100 s = s + n n = n + 1 Loop Label2.Caption = 1+2+3+…+100 = s End Sub 还可以改为直到型: Private Sub Command1_Click() Dim s As Integer, n As Integer s = 0: n = 1 Do Until n 100 s = s + n n = n + 1 Loop Label2.Caption = 1+2+3+…+100 = s End Sub 后测型Do…Loop循环 其语法为 Do [〈语句列1〉] [Exit Do] [〈语句列2〉] Loop [{While | Until} 〈条件〉] 输入有效数字的位数,利用下述公式计算圆周率π的近似值: F T F 条件表达式? 语句块1 开始(start) …… …… 结束(end) 条件表达式的初值 Exit Do? 语句块2 改变条件表达式 T 设计步骤如下: (1) 建立应用程序用户界面与设置对象属性。 (2) 编写程序代码。 根据流程图,可以写出命令按钮Command1的Click事件代码为 Private Sub Command1_Click()
您可能关注的文档
- 建模讲座 蚁群算法.ppt
- 建模讲座 动态规划.ppt
- 简历培训 高级讲师.ppt
- 简介-拉式与推式-.ppt
- 建设部建城2002221号讲陈雪仙温州.ppt
- 建设工程施工合同培训教程1.ppt
- 技术经济学第1章绪论 任选 陈2010 3.ppt
- 简历动画@无忧ppt.pptx
- 建筑材料 ppt09cec6.ppt
- 建筑初步03 西方古典建筑.ppt
- 2024年企业人力资源管理师之二级人力资源管理师模拟考试试卷A卷含答案完整版720780578.pdf
- 2024年检验类之临床医学检验技术(师)全真模拟考试试卷B卷含答案优质 完整版720844645.pdf
- 2024年四川省成都市第七中学初中学校中考一模物理试题(解析版).pdf
- 2024年二级建造师之二建水利水电实务过关检测试卷B卷附答案 .pdf
- 2024年教师资格之中学思想品德学科知识与教学能力综合检测试卷A卷含完整版720848701.pdf
- 2024年教师信息技术2.0教研组研修计划(优秀模板6篇)(6) .pdf
- 2024年教师资格之幼儿综合素质通关提分题库及完整答案 .pdf
- 2024年心理咨询师之心理咨询师基础知识通关提分题库及完整答案完整版720794806.pdf
- 2024年消防设施操作员之消防设备初级技能题库附答案(典型题).pdf
- 2024年小学信息技术工作计划样本(三篇) .pdf
文档评论(0)